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ive within 60 minutes of your call, equipped with the latest technology to assess the extent of the damage. We'll identify the source of the leak or flood, and develop a customized plan to address the issue.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our technicians will use powerful pumps and equipment to extract as much water as possible from your garage, reducing the risk of further damage and mold growth. This process typically takes 2-4 hours, depending on the amount of water present.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to dry your garage, ensuring the area is completely free of moisture. This process usually takes 3-5 days,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Deodorizing

Our technicians will use specialized equipment to sanitize and deodorize your garage, removing any remaining moisture and unpleasant odors.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a fresh, clean environment.

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air

Once the drying and sanitizing process is complete, our team will work with you to repair or replace any damaged materials, ensuring your garage is restored to its original condition. We'll also provide guidance on preventing future water damage and maintaining your garage's integrity.

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ost In Mount Olive, NC

The cost of garage water damage cleanup in Mount Olive, NC,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on real-world costs, and we'll provide you with a detailed breakdown of the costs involved. Don't let the cost of repairs hold you back - our team will work with you to find a solution that fits your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 The amount of water present, the size of the affected area, and the equ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of moisture present, and the equipment required.
Sanitizing and Deodorizing $500 - $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ment required.
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 - $10,000 The extent of the damage, the materials required, and the labor involved.
Free Estimate and Inspection $0 - $200 The complexity of the job and the time required for the inspection.
